• For the maintenance and cleaning of your kettle, refer to the
chapters "Cleaning and Maintenance" and "Descaling"�
• The surfaces are likely to heat up during use�
• Do not use the kettle when you have wet hands or bare feet�
• Remove the plug immediately if you notice any abnormality
when the appliance is on�
• Do not pull on the cord to remove the plug�
• Do not let the power cord hang from a table or work surface to
prevent the appliance from falling�
• Always remain vigilant when the appliance is on and pay
particular attention to the steam released from the spout,
which is very hot�
• Only touch the kettle via the handle�
• Never touch the lid� The water is boiling hot, so the lid
becomes very hot�
• Never move the kettle while it is on�
• Protect the appliance from moisture and sources of high

temperatures (cooker, oven, hotplates, etc�)�
• If your appliance falls or is damaged in any way, have it
checked by an approved service centre�
• Unplug your appliance when not used for prolonged periods
and when cleaning�

• It is advisable that you supervise children to ensure they do
not play with the appliance�
• This appliance is not designed to boil anything other than
water� Its use is excluded for any other liquid or solid�
• Your product must be used on a flat, stable surface�
• This appliance is not designed to be used in conjunction with a
separate timer or with a control system used at a distance�
• If you accidentally switch the kettle on while it is empty, the
thermal protection device will automatically switch the kettle
off� If this should happen, leave the kettle to cool before filling
it with cold water and turning it on again�
